Problem
Existing game tables are difficult for consumers to assemble, lacking a simple and efficient mechanism for combining the table frame and face board.
Innovation Solution
A game table design featuring a rectangular table frame with elongated transverse connection boards, support boards, and adjustable assemblies that facilitate easy alignment and secure attachment of the table face board to the frame, using locating members and adjustable components to simplify assembly.

A game table assembly structure includes a table frame and a table face board, the table frame is composed of two pairs of sideboards. Four connection boards are disposed on top edges of the sideboards. At least one support board is disposed in the table frame with two ends connected with a pair of sideboards. The top edge of the support board is higher than the connection boards. Four connecting boards are connected under the bottom face of the table face board and define a locating space therein. When assembled, the table face board is placed on the table frame with the connecting boards and the connecting boards up and down corresponding to each other for connection, the top end of the support board fitted in the locating space. The table face board can be easily located on and assembled with the table frame.
